Transaction 58d696fbd762bc2c48da629d8069a5191ff10dbff17e151142590badec3eabfc
1 Input
1 Output
-
58d696fbd762bc2c48da629d8069a5191ff10dbff17e151142590badec3eabfc:0
- value
- 59096
- script pubkey
- OP_0 OP_PUSHBYTES_20 6911abe2089ecaaa15c4946c9f1cc01f8dbfee3d
- address
- bc1qdyg6hcsgnm9259wyj3kf78xqr7xmlm3ajt50sf